German Umlauts (US alt) Extension

Keyboard Extension for Chrome OS. Use German Umlauts on US Keyboard. For example: alt + a = ä, alt + U = Ü etc.

Base Language is German, means that you need to have German enabled under your Chrome OS Languages and input method settings in order to choose the German Umlauts keyboard layout.

Base Keyboard Layout is US, means that it will work with every Chromebook shipped with US Keyboard like the Pixelbook sold in the US.

Method 2: Download German Umlauts (US alt) extension for Chrome and install in Developer Mode

This is another method to install German Umlauts (US alt) extension manually, but the twist is that here, you install by enabling the developer mode option provided in Google Chrome. This mode is commonly used for testing extensions or running unpublished tools.

Step 1: Download the German Umlauts (US alt) extension file

Select and download the German Umlauts (US alt) extension by clicking the 'Download CRX' button on the website.

Step 2: Extract the downloaded contents

Convert the file to a ZIP file if it is in CRX format then extract the German Umlauts (US alt) extension zip file or folder that you downloaded. Make sure you extract it using the same folder name and keep it safely in another folder, so you don't delete it by mistake. The extracted folder will be needed to keep your German Umlauts (US alt) extension running.

Step 3: Open Chrome Extension Setting Page

In the address bar of Google Chrome, type chrome://extensions and open the Chrome Extension Page.

Step 4: Enable Developer Mode

After opening the Chrome Extension page, look at the top right side, and you will find the toggle option of "Developer mode."Simply enable that developer mode option.

Step 5: Load the Unpacked Extension

Once you enable the developer mode option, you will see the menu of Load Unpacked, Pack Extensions and Update. From that, select the option "Load unpacked."

Step 6: Select the Extension Folder

Once the pop-up opens upon clicking Load unpacked, select the German Umlauts (US alt) extension directory and click on the "Select Folder "button.

Step 7: Confirm and Install

After you select an extension folder of a Google Chrome extension you're installing manually, confirm its installation for the final time and let the installation complete.
